Transaction 750aaf7bab3319544871f380b2e34708e22e05e0117df3d6e12d1192eb8e949e
3 Input
2 Outputs
- 750aaf7bab3319544871f380b2e34708e22e05e0117df3d6e12d1192eb8e949e:0
- 750aaf7bab3319544871f380b2e34708e22e05e0117df3d6e12d1192eb8e949e:1
value 7007288
address 16XgmtUW1CJYYo7aEgpbBwwzYiCWUHmQsX
value 786366
address 1KY4WYSyWazaSXh23jx74pAoUjzFBKhJSL